28.2.2.3 Umbilical Tunnel
Reconstruction Technique:
Belly Button like aTunnel
The navel is considered a tube for some authors
and its correction is based on the purpose. There
are techniques for each type of belly button,
which differ in depth and diameter, and they
attempt to simulate the side walls of the belly button [33, 34].
In very thin patients who do not have enough
skin in the umbilical area, even using the bottom
of the navel to try to get deeper, shallow navel
cannot be avoided. In this case, the umbilical wall
should also be reconstructed to simulate a greater
depth. Thus, local aps are used. However, there
is the inconvenience of leaving apparent scars.
Therefore, it would be more indicated in patients
with light skin and less likely to develop hypertrophic scars.
Tunneled neo-navel surgery is based on the
making of V-shaped aps from a midline incision,
two upper and two lower aps. The idea is to simulate the umbilical tube wall tissue with an upper
and lower ap, which rotates in the opposite
direction against each other. The third ap should
have the most central epithelialized portion to
cross under one of the aps and be xed to the
central portion to simulate the bottom of the navel.
The fourth ap is excised. The drawback is the
risk of the middle scar becoming apparent from
the poor skin quality of the patient. But it is a
well-indicated technique in cases of navel amputation, as it becomes more predictable and highly
reproducible (Figs.28.1, 28.2, 28.3, and 28.4).

28.2.2.4 New Approach (Associate
Old Stump
withNeoumbilicoplasty
Technique)
We describe this technique as hybrid because it
associates the xation of the abdominal ap dermis in aponeurosis, as in the technique we
described in 2013 [31] and the utilization of the
remaining umbilical stump.
The umbilical stump is xed in the aponeurosis of the rectus abdominis, especially in cases of
shallower appearance. A vertex-shaped portion is
appended with a vertex to the umbilical center in
the position between 12 and 2 o’clock and the
lower second between 6 and 8 o’clock. The
abdominal ap is degreased in the portion that
will rest on the old stump. In this degreased
region, six nylon 2.0 xation points are made up
to the rectum aponeurosis, causing the stump to
be covered by the skin of the abdominal ap. The
points are in the following positions: 12, 2, 4, 6,
8, and 10 h. After all closure of the abdominal
wall, the skin is inserted, making two small
V-aps, which will be tted and sutured within
the triangular designs (Fig.28.5).
This technique proved to be much more effective in relation to aesthetic results, depth, and hidden scars compared to neoumbilicoplasty without
utilization of the stump (Table28.1).

28.3 Postoperative Care (Wound
Dressing)
Subclinical local infection can be a limiting factor for the nal result and for the increased risk of
suture dehiscence. For this reason, antibiotic
ointment and gauze are used on the navel at the
end of the surgery, and it is maintained for
15days, when the use of silicone gel starts twice
a day for 4months. The early use of orthoses is
avoided so as not to force the scar and break the
suture, which are started after 30 days. As a
result, a lower rate of these complications was
observed.

28.4 Outcomes andPrognosis
The use of new techniques associating the construction of a tunnel over a remaining umbilical
stump proved to be much more effective in relation to the aesthetic, depth, and hidden scarring
results in relation to neoumbilicoplasty without
using the stump. In techniques that did not use
the remaining umbilical stump, the navels were
shallow, and there were high rates of reoperation
to make it deeper.
The making of new navels or the correction of
umbilical complications can be performed under
local anesthesia in an isolated procedure.
28.5 Complications
The incidence of seroma can also increase the
risk of dehiscence of the stitches when it drains
through that region. Therefore, the points of
adhesion of the ap on the abdominal wall are
important to reduce this incidence. The infection
rate can be decreased with the use of local antibiotic ointments. Keeping the measurement of the
new umbilical design between 1.8 and 2.0cm is
important to avoid wide and ugly navels.
Techniques that do not use the anterior umbilical
stump tend to result in shallow and unlit navels.
Those that do not x the abdominal ap around
the stump may result in hypertrophic scars and
stigmatized navels similar to a cacimba.

29.1 Umbilical Hernia
29.1.1 Introduction
Umbilicus is located in the midline, halfway
between the xyphoid process and the pubic symphysis. It is the remainder of the insertion of the
umbilical cord and it is a weakness point in the
abdominal wall. It is protected in the lower part
by the obliterated uracus and the medial umbilical ligaments and in the upper part by the round
hepatic ligament. The limits are the two rectus
sheaths on both sides, the umbilical fascia posteriorly and the linea alba anteriorly [1].
Umbilical hernia is located at or near the
umbilicus in a range from 3cm above and 3cm
below [2]. It is a common entity with higher prevalence in women than in men, with a 3:1 ratio [3].

29.1.2 Patient Selection andTiming
29.1.2.1 Patient Selection
Patient selection is important in order to reduce
or even avoid postoperative complications.
Certain comorbidities such as tobacco use, obesity, diabetes, and malnutrition are related to
postoperative complications and should be modied before surgery.
Tobacco impairs wound healing and increases
the risk of infection; so, nonsmoking during the
last 4weeks before surgery reduces the infection
rate. Malnutrition should also be avoided with
protein repletion before the intervention.
Obesity and diabetes impair tissue perfusion
and immune response; patients ought to lose
weight before surgery and keep a strict control
of glycemia to reduce postoperative complications [7].

29.1.2.2 Timing: Umbilical Hernia
Before, During andAfter
Pregnancy
There is still no consensus about the perfect timing for surgery in a pregnant woman or planning
pregnancy. Surgeons usually recommend oneyear lapse between the hernia intervention and
pregnancy. There is no evidence support, however, if an early pregnancy increases the rate of
recurrence [8].
In a pregnant woman, when the hernia is small
and asymptomatic, it may be better to postpone
the surgery until she gives birth [8]. Unlike, when
the hernia is symptomatic, some studies describe
a high rate (58%) of complications (strangulation
or incarceration), so they recommend elective
surgery before complications appear and before
delivery, with low risk. The most frequent complication is surgical site infection, but the main
disadvantage is the scant data regarding recurrence rate [9, 10].
After childbirth, elective repair is possible
8weeks postpartum, but it is better to wait one
year for the patient to recover and return to normal body weight. If the woman would like to
have more children, surgery can be postponed for
a longer time [8] (Table29.1).
Another option that has been described is
repairing the umbilical hernia during the cesarean section. It is an optimal therapeutic option
that takes more time than performing only the
cesarean, but it is safe, there is no additional pain,
neither more morbidity, and avoids readmission.
However, there is still little report experience
about recurrence [9, 11, 12] and some studies
describe scarce aesthetic results and high incidence of complications such as skin necrosis,
wound infection, seroma, and hematoma; so, further studies are needed [13].
There is also hesitance about the use of mesh
reparation during pregnancy, because there is
high risk of lateral mesh detachment or inadequate overlap of the hernia defect. Furthermore,
the mesh may restrict the elasticity of the abdominal wall leading to associated pain [14]. A study
made by Oma etal. found no differences in the
recurrence rate between mesh repair and simple
suture repair in women who underwent surgery
before pregnancy. They hypothesized that as the
pregnancy progresses, the tension on the hernia
repair increases. This tension may cause mesh
detachment or migration and explain the lack of
mesh benet. Besides, they also concluded that
umbilical hernia repair was associated with a
greater risk of recurrence compared with epigastric hernia repair [15].

29.1.3.2 Diagnosis
The diagnosis is easy and usually performed
through clinical exploration. The increase in the
abdominal pressure helps the diagnosis;, however, in certain patients, such as obese or when
the hernia is small, an ultrasound or a CT is
needed.

29.1.5 Surgical Technique
29.1.5.1 Patient Positioning
The patient is placed in supine position in the
operating room table and secured to avoid any
shifting although no angulation of the able is
needed. The arms are usually open in the form of
a cross. The surgeon is located in the right side of
the patient and the rst assistant on the opposite
one. When there is a laparoscopic approach, the
surgeons are also placed at both sides of the
patient and the television on his/her feet.
